In 1990, a routine British Airways flight from Birmingham to Málaga turned into a harrowing test of survival and human resilience. Captain Tim Lancaster, commanding a BAC 1-11 aircraft, experienced an unprecedented emergency when the cockpit windshield suddenly failed at approximately 17,000 feet. The explosive decompression violently pulled Lancaster halfway out of the plane, leaving only his legs inside the cockpit. The sudden loss of structural integrity exposed him to extreme wind, freezing temperatures, and dangerously low oxygen levels, while debris and instruments were blown throughout the cockpit. In a matter of seconds, a typical flight became a fight for life, demanding immediate action and composure from the entire crew.

Flight attendant Nigel Ogden was the first to react, demonstrating extraordinary courage under unimaginable conditions. Seeing Lancaster being torn from the cockpit, Ogden grabbed the captain’s legs and held on with every ounce of strength. The force of the wind threatened to overwhelm him, frostbite began forming, and debris pelted his body relentlessly. Despite these dangers, Ogden refused to let go, maintaining his grip for nearly twenty minutes. His quick thinking and physical determination became the pivotal factor in preventing Lancaster from being completely ejected from the aircraft, highlighting how human reflexes can become lifesaving in the most extreme circumstances.

Meanwhile, co-pilot Alastair Atchison assumed control of the plane, exemplifying calm and precise decision-making under intense pressure. Faced with a cockpit in chaos and a captain partially outside the aircraft, Atchison stabilized the plane and reduced its speed to lessen the force of the wind. He then initiated an emergency descent toward Southampton, demonstrating the critical role of training and professionalism in aviation safety. His ability to maintain control of the BAC 1-11, despite the violent turbulence and structural instability, prevented a catastrophe and ensured that Lancaster and the rest of the crew had a chance to survive.

Another flight attendant, Simon Rogers, joined the effort to assist Ogden in holding Lancaster. By supporting Lancaster’s legs, Rogers allowed Ogden to conserve energy and continue his grip, exemplifying the effectiveness of teamwork under life-threatening conditions. The coordination between the crew members, their communication despite deafening noise, and their shared focus on a single objective—keeping the captain inside the aircraft—was critical to the outcome. Their actions underscore the importance of preparedness, quick thinking, and mutual reliance in situations where seconds can determine life or death.

Upon reaching Southampton, emergency services were ready to provide immediate medical care, a crucial component of the successful resolution. Lancaster survived with frostbite, shock, and multiple fractures, an outcome considered extraordinary given the extreme altitude and exposure. Subsequent investigation revealed that the windshield failure had been caused by incorrectly installed bolts during routine maintenance, a small oversight that nearly resulted in tragedy.
